Handmade Cloth Topsy Turvy Dolls


White and Mammy Topsy Turvy Doll
Two dolls in one! Display a white prim Annie one day, and a black prim Annie the next! These dolls have been called topsy turvy, upside down dolls, or awake asleep dolls.

This doll is made of muslin and is 19" tall. Black doll is hand dyed a beautiful reddish honey brown. Hand painted face, including eyes, noses and smiles. I named them “Vivian” and “Gramcracker”. My great grandma’s name was Vivian and I always called her “Granny Gramcrackers”.
